Learning to Drive in Goldthorpe
Goldthorpe is a small Yorkshire town with short drives into Doncaster. Learners here get a mix of suburban streets and busy A-road practice. There are six local approved instructors, so availability can be limited at peak times. Average hourly lesson price is around 35.
Nearest Test Centre: Doncaster
The nearest DVSA test centre is Doncaster, about 5.9 miles away by road. Expect tests to use a mix of town routes and nearby A-roads and to travel into the wider Doncaster area for some manoeuvres. Doncaster recorded a 46.3% pass rate and ran 7,927 tests in the year 2024-2025, Data source: DVSA, 2024-2025. Male and female pass splits at Doncaster were 49.3% and 43.3% respectively, Data source: DVSA, 2024-2025.
Data source: DVSA (2024-2025)
Pass Rate Analysis
Doncaster's pass rate of 46.3% sits just below the national average of 47.3%, Data source: DVSA, 2024-2025. Male learners in Doncaster passed at 49.3% while female learners passed at 43.3%, Data source: DVSA, 2024-2025. Nearby Rotherham showed a lower pass rate of 37.1% and Doncaster (Legacy Centre) was 32.5%, Data source: DVSA, 2024-2025. Those figures suggest test outcomes vary considerably across nearby centres, so choosing the right test location can make a difference.
Local Driving Tips
Start lessons on quieter residential streets before moving to Barnsley Road (A635) to build confidence on faster roads. Practice merging and lane discipline where local A-roads meet town junctions, and be ready for traffic at peak times heading towards Doncaster. There are level crossings and a station area to watch for, so practise controlled stops and observation. Roundabouts near the main routes can be busy, so rehearse filtering and lane choice well in advance. Expect potholes on some minor roads and adjust speed and positioning accordingly.

Getting Started
Apply for your provisional driving licence, then book regular lessons with a local instructor to build skills on both residential streets and A-roads. Book and pass the theory test before you take the practical. When you feel ready, book your practical at Doncaster, which is the closest DVSA centre at about 5.9 miles.
